This small sterling silver salt spoon measuring 2.4 inches long was made by Wallace Silversmith, USA in the famous Grande Baroque pattern in the 1940-1950s. Salt spoons were made to be used with the individual open salt dishes used with a formal dining service. A cute little piece and very collectible.
